Transaction 24e3f85f77a93312ceafc692912707bb803abfca79664f8c322561217c500ad4
1 Input
1 Output
-
24e3f85f77a93312ceafc692912707bb803abfca79664f8c322561217c500ad4:0
- value
- 8406
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 baa003a76800dc99d6d5a48fc46efc873d1d2f91 OP_EQUAL
- address
- 3JhoJDBTjX91PDHdeRefv6gYz7WMBg3RJV